In this function, you will then be responsible for looking after problematic or defaulted credit commitments with private and business customers who require intensive treatment or restructuring due to their risk profile. This function includes risk analysis and customer support. You represent the interests of the bank, possibly contrary to the interests of the borrower or his other creditors. Your goal will be to reduce the risks for the bank with appropriate use of resources, to achieve the sustainable restructuring of the customer and to keep him for the bank as far as economically reasonable.
